    Abstract: PROBLEM TO BE SOLVED: To control a continuously variable head lamp so as to be properly operated over a broad range of ambient light conditions. SOLUTION: This continuously variable head lamp has an effective illumination range by changing at least one parameter selected from a set including an aim horizontal direction, an aim vertical direction, and projected illumination. A system for automatically controlling the continuously variable head lamp mounted in a vehicle includes an imaging system which can determine the position of the lateral direction and height of a head lamp of an incoming vehicle and a tail lamp of an antecedent vehicle. This system further includes a control unit which can capture an image from the front face of the control vehicle. This image covers a glare area including a point where a driver in an incoming or antecedent vehicle perceives the head lamp and causes an excessive level of glare. When at least one vehicle is within the glare area, the illumination range of the head lamp is narrowed. COPYRIGHT: (C)2004,JPO&NCIPI

    Abstract: PROBLEM TO BE SOLVED: To provide a control circuit for controlling various functions of an image array sensor such as an active pixel image array sensor. SOLUTION: The present invention relates to a control system for controlling an image array sensor and controlling communication between the image array sensor and a microcontroller by way of a serial communication interface. The control system is able to efficiently control various aspects of the image array sensor such as windowing, mode of operation, sensitivity as well as other parameters in order to reduce the data throughput. An important aspect of the invention relates to the fact that the control circuit can be rather easily and efficiently configured in CMOS with relatively few output pins which enable the control circuit to be rather easily and efficiently integrated with CMOS based on the image array sensor and even the microcontroller to reduce the part count and thus, the overall cost of the system.     Abstract: PROBLEM TO BE SOLVED: To provide a lamp capable of reducing the glare of embarrassing a driver of a leading vehicle. SOLUTION: A sensor array 52 and a control unit 44 are included in a system 40 for controlling at least one vehicular exterior lighting fixture 22 of a control object vehicle. The sensor array 52 can detect a light level in front of the control object vehicle. The control unit 44 communicates with the sensor array 52 and at least the one vehicular exterior lighting fixture, and measures a distance and an angle up to the leading vehicle from at least the one vehicular exterior lighting fixture of the control object vehicle. The control unit 44 controls operation of at least the one vehicular exterior lighting fixture as a function of the distance and the angle based on output from the sensor array 52. At least the one vehicular exterior lighting fixture 22 can operate so as to prevent impartment of the glare of embarrassing the driver of the leading vehicle. COPYRIGHT: (C)2009,JPO&INPIT
